Check the Power Supply
The first thing you should do when your heated towel rack isn’t working is to check the power supply. Sounds obvious, right? But you’d be surprised how many times the problem is as simple as a loose plug or a tripped circuit breaker.
First, take a look at the plug. Make sure it’s firmly inserted into the outlet. Sometimes, over time, the plug can become loose, especially if the outlet is old or if there’s been a bit of movement around the area. If it seems loose, try unplugging it and plugging it back in firmly.
Next, check the circuit breaker. Head to your electrical panel and look for the breaker that controls the circuit where the towel rack is connected. If the breaker has tripped, it’ll be in the "off" position. Flip it back to the "on" position. If it trips again right away, there might be a more serious electrical issue. In that case, it’s probably best to call an electrician.
Inspect the Heating Element
If the power supply is okay, the next thing to look at is the heating element. The heating element is what actually warms up the towel rack.
Start by feeling the rack. If it’s completely cold, there could be a problem with the heating element. Sometimes, the element can burn out over time, especially if it’s been used a lot.
To check the heating element, you’ll need a multimeter. If you don’t have one, you can usually borrow one from a friend or rent one from a hardware store. Set the multimeter to the resistance setting. Then, carefully disconnect the wires from the heating element (make sure the power is off first!). Touch the probes of the multimeter to the terminals of the heating element. If the multimeter shows infinite resistance, it means the heating element is broken and needs to be replaced.
Examine the Thermostat
The thermostat is another important component of a heated towel rack. It’s responsible for regulating the temperature. If the thermostat isn’t working properly, the towel rack might not heat up or might overheat.
To check the thermostat, you can try adjusting the temperature setting. If the rack doesn’t respond to the changes, the thermostat could be faulty. You can also use a multimeter to test the thermostat. Set the multimeter to the continuity setting. Touch the probes to the terminals of the thermostat. If there’s no continuity, it means the thermostat is broken and needs to be replaced.
Look for Physical Damage
Sometimes, the problem with a non – working towel rack can be due to physical damage. Check the rack for any visible signs of damage, such as cracks, breaks, or bent parts.
If you find any damage, it could be affecting the electrical connections or the heating element. For example, a crack in the rack could expose the wiring, which can lead to a short circuit. If the damage is minor, you might be able to repair it yourself. But if it’s extensive, it’s probably best to replace the entire rack.
Check the Wiring
The wiring in the towel rack is crucial for it to work properly. Over time, the wiring can become frayed or loose, which can cause the rack to stop working.
Inspect the wiring for any signs of damage, such as exposed wires or loose connections. If you find any frayed wires, you can try to repair them using electrical tape. But if the damage is severe, it’s best to replace the wiring.
To check the connections, make sure all the wires are securely attached to the terminals. If a wire has come loose, carefully reconnect it.
Consider the Installation
Sometimes, the problem with a non – working towel rack can be related to the installation. If the rack wasn’t installed correctly, it might not work properly.
Check to make sure the rack is properly mounted on the wall. If it’s loose, it could be affecting the electrical connections. Also, make sure the wiring was installed according to the manufacturer’s instructions. If you’re not sure about the installation, it might be a good idea to have a professional take a look.
